The short notes:
I really dig this art style. Even more than I like Stray Gods, still going for a comic look, but this is a more traditional comics style, and it's just fantastic. The voice acting is a bit of a mixed bag, but it's more good than not. And the stuff that isn't great, is still both entertaining and serviceable. I personally kind of have a love/hate relationship with point n click adventure games. But I'd encourage folks to check it out, for sure.

Quick housecleaning note... Yeah, I don't know what my deal was. I explained the story totally and completely wrong. While it was right there in front of me. I don't know what caused me to do that. I guess my memory of the story was kind of vague. For the record. Our father was an explorer, not a scientist. Our mother was queen of the Moon. But there was no invasion, her people turned on her. She fled with your father to Earth, and they had you. Now your mother is dying and your father is too old and weak to go himself. You need to go to the moon to collect ?gems? and save her. That's the actual plot. My synopsis had little to do with what it's really about. My apologies. Mea Culpa.
I actually do really love this game. As a total package it just works for me. There are flaws to be sure. It's greatest crime is being slightly basic. But combined with everything else including the price point, it more than the sum of it's parts individually would be.
